“Rapmaster” P.N. News was introduced to WCW fans in 1991 and, much like he did with his finisher - a top rope splash called “The Broken Record” - landed with a thud. He would come to the ring to some generic early 90s hip-hop, climb into the ring, and start to rap - with lyrics that were usually just a variation of “yo baby, yo baby, yo.” Seriously. Sadly, on top of being a not-so-good rapper, News was also a not-so-good wrestler. Combine that with a predominately southern US crowd that hadn’t really embraced hip-hop (not trying to generalise anybody but, you know…), and PN News flopped worse than Young MC’s second album.
